A few warblers were moving through the yard as I went out this morning.
Canada 1
Chestnut-sided 2
Black-and-white 1
While walking my neighbors farm yesterday I happened to meet him going in as I was leaving. He told
me he had been seeing a pair of owls in his barn and had seen them sitting snuggled up together like
love birds. He invited me to look for them. I checked the barn this morning and found a Barn Owl
sitting up high on the rafters.
While walking his field road I counted 158 Orb Weavers (spiders) in approx. 300' of fence line.
Certainly the most I had ever seen.
